Elements Influencing Headphone Prices
Several key aspects affect the price of headphones, which consist of:
1. Kind of Headphones
- Over-Ear: Known for their convenience and sound quality, over-ear headphones usually range from mid to high price points.
- On-Ear: These offer a more portable alternative and generally sit at a lower price compared to over-ear alternatives.
- In-Ear: Also referred to as earphones, these are generally more budget-friendly, but high-end designs can be costly.
- Real Wireless: TWS headphones have actually acquired appeal for their benefit but can vary substantially in cost.
2. Brand Reputation
- Brands like Bose and Sennheiser command higher costs due to their established reputation and quality control, while lesser-known brands may provide more affordable alternatives without substantial brand name support.
3. Sound Quality
- Headphones with much better chauffeurs and advanced sound innovations, such as sound cancellation or adaptive noise settings, come at a premium price.
4. Product and Build Quality
- Headphones made from long lasting materials like metal and top quality plastics are usually more pricey due to the increased production cost.
5. Functions
- Wired vs. Wireless: Wireless headphones often cost more due to Bluetooth innovation and battery management systems.
- Noise Cancellation: Active sound cancellation innovation substantially increases the price of headphones.
- Microphone Quality: Integrated high-quality microphones improve functionality, particularly for players and professionals, causing a higher price tag.
6. Target market
- Headphones created for audiophiles or expert studio use typically fall within a greater price bracket due to precision engineering and premium materials.
Headphones Pricing Tiers
When shopping for headphones, it can be beneficial to categorize them into unique pricing tiers. Below is a breakdown of pricing tiers and examples of popular headphone designs in each category.
Price Range | Description | Example Models |
---|---|---|
Budget (<<₤ 50)Basic features, decent quality, ideal for casual usage. | Anker SoundCore, JLab Audio | |
Mid-range (₤ 50 - ₤ 150) | Balanced sound quality, more comfort, additional features like noise seclusion. | Sony WH-CH710N, Apple AirPods |
High-end (₤ 150 - ₤ 300) | Superior sound quality, exceptional construct quality, features like sound cancellation. | Bose QuietComfort 35 II, Sennheiser HD 558 |
Audiophile (₤ 300+) | Exceptional audio fidelity, typically including high-end products and technologies. | Audeze LCD-X, Focal Stellia |
Move Beyond Price Tags: An In-depth Comparison
For consumers considering their headphone purchase beyond simply price, understanding the advantages and prospective downsides of each classification is important. Here's how they stack up against one another:
Budget Headphones
- Pros: Affordable, decent sound quality for everyday tasks, lightweight.
- Cons: Durability issues, minimal features, poorer sound quality compared to more costly designs.
Mid-range Headphones
- Pros: Great balance of price and performance, additional functions like much better cushioning and sound isolation.
- Cons: May still lack the sound quality of higher-end options.
High-End Headphones
- Pros: Outstanding sound quality, high convenience levels, flexible features like noise cancellation.
- Cons: Price can be prohibitively high for casual listeners.
Audiophile
- Pros: Exceptional sound reproduction, premium products, concentrated on producing an immersive listening experience.
- Cons: Not ideal for casual listeners due to high price; may need additional amplifications.
